Six EPFL industrial partners each have a problem they haven't cracked. From 15 September, they're handing them to students at the Open Innovation Lab.
You're a master's or PhD student at EPFL. A head of innovation from one of EPFL’s industrial partners has just put a problem in front of your team: redesign a product line for circularity, automate production at scale, or find a new application for a technology the company already owns and has never used this way. Would you be up to the challenge?
Starting this semester, the Open Innovation Lab is a new course, that offers master's or PhD student the opportunity to work in a small interdisciplinary team, with a real client and fourteen weeks to turn their problem into something they can act on. They'd have until December to hand over a report including an executive summary, and then present the strategy to executives in the company, getting first-hand experience at defending their ideas outside EPFL’s ivory tower.
“This class is designed to bring young engineers out of their comfort zone. In industry, demonstrating non-technical skills, such as understanding one’s role in value creation, is a clear differentiator in determining one’s role in a company,” says Cudré-Mauroux, SICPA CTO and co-lecturer.
While the course is taught within the Master in Management, Technology and Entrepreneurship, it is open to students from all EPFL programs. And they will not go unguided through this challenge but carefully mentored along the way. The Innovation Lab will be driven, and not taught in the traditional sense, by Cudré-Mauroux and EPFL lecturer Enrico Bergamini.
Bergamini, whose path has taken him from aerospace engineering to the automotive industry and back to academia, sees the course as a logical conjugation of EPFL’s ecosystem: brilliant students and cutting-edge companies. “It’s where the magic happens,” as he puts it. “And the networking element is an essential part of the course. This is a foot in the door for the future: a semester project, a Master thesis or even a first job experience after graduating.”
And while EPFL students are accustomed to working on hard, open-ended problems in class, someone has always known what a good answer looks like. Here nobody does: not the lecturers, and not the companies bringing the problems. “Whether anything happens to a team's recommendation depends entirely on whether it is good enough, and specific enough, to survive a room full of people with budgets and implementation experience,” adds Cudré-Mauroux.
And herein lies the crux of the six challenges: They go beyond purely technical problems with a clean outcome. Instead, students will be guided on how to manage the solution through the human and organizational complexity of a company. And, perhaps most importantly, how to take responsibility for the decisions that have led to their solution.
